Angela had just been promoted to department chair at the college where she taught. Although she treated everyone the same, several of the male professors in the department were put off by Angela's requests. As a result, the female professors thought of Angela as fair and equitable in her treatment, but the male professors began resenting her and openly challenging her position on several issues. The male professors probably treated Angela that way because they Group of answer choices

a. they were culturally insensitive to Angela's professional positionb. they perceived Angela's professional position as masculine and socially threateningc. they were physiologically opposed to Angela's professional positiond. they were prejudiced against Angela because of her professional position

Answer: b) they perceived Angela's professional position as masculine and socially threatening

Step-by-step explanation: The male professors are having the feeling of intimidation on society level as they are not comfortable with the fact that a female is appropriate for the job position that she has been promoted to .They had the mind-set of that such positions can be only occupied by the male .

Other options are incorrect because culture is not a factor in the situation rather gender is considered, physiology concept is not present and her position has not swayed them rather they think females are not the correct person for the position .Thus, the correct option is option (b).
